sql語句

如何使用 SQL 單語句從多張表中刪除數據,即使其中一張表沒有匹配項?-小浪學習網

如何使用 SQL 單語句從多張表中刪除數據,即使其中一張表沒有匹配項?

sql單語句實現多表刪除 此處要實現通過單一語句從三張表中刪除相關記錄,目標是通過dishid執行刪除操作。 提供的初始sql語句中,使用了inner join連接三個表,但由于第三張表沒有任何匹配記錄,...
站長的頭像-小浪學習網月度會員站長2個月前
2911
mysql 有存儲過程嗎-小浪學習網

mysql 有存儲過程嗎

MySQL 提供存儲過程,它是一個預編譯的 SQL 代碼塊,可封裝著復雜邏輯、提高代碼重用性和安全性。其核心功能包括循環、條件語句、游標和事務控制。通過調用存儲過程,用戶只需輸入輸出即可完成...
站長的頭像-小浪學習網月度會員站長2個月前
3312
Navicat如何批量修改特定條件的數據-小浪學習網

Navicat如何批量修改特定條件的數據

Navicat的查詢構建器使批量修改數據高效便捷:選擇目標表并構建SQL語句(UPDATE users SET status = 'active' WHERE country = 'China')。注意避免SQL注入,確保數據類型匹配。仔細檢查條件,...
站長的頭像-小浪學習網月度會員站長2個月前
219
Navicat批量修改數據如何使用觸發器-小浪學習網

Navicat批量修改數據如何使用觸發器

巧妙運用數據庫觸發器可提升 Navicat 批量修改數據的效率和可靠性,避免常見陷阱,如:循環依賴導致數據庫死鎖;復雜的觸發器邏輯影響性能;缺乏完善的錯誤處理機制;調試困難。最佳實踐包括:...
站長的頭像-小浪學習網月度會員站長1個月前
4214
考取Oracle認證OCP證書的學習路徑和經驗分享-小浪學習網

考取Oracle認證OCP證書的學習路徑和經驗分享

ocp認證需要先通過oca認證,并熟悉oracle數據庫的架構、sql、pl/sql、性能調優和備份恢復。1.通過oca認證打基礎。2.制定詳細學習計劃,復習考試大綱。3.多做練習題,提高實際操作能力。4.加入學...
站長的頭像-小浪學習網月度會員站長1個月前
4912
后端數據權限控制:如何高效安全地驗證用戶數據修改權限?-小浪學習網

后端數據權限控制:如何高效安全地驗證用戶數據修改權限?

后端數據權限控制最佳實踐:安全高效的用戶權限驗證 在構建安全可靠的系統時,數據權限控制至關重要。本文將介紹一種高效安全的策略,用于驗證后端數據修改操作的權限。 數據庫數據示例: [ { &...
站長的頭像-小浪學習網月度會員站長3個月前
3614
Spring Boot整合MyBatis:@Mapper、@MapperScan和mybatis.mapper-locations如何協同工作?-小浪學習網

Spring Boot整合MyBatis:@Mapper、@MapperScan和mybatis.mapper-locations如何協同工作?

Spring Boot集成MyBatis時,@Mapper、@MapperScan注解和mybatis.mapper-locations配置文件參數如何協同工作?本文將詳細解釋它們之間的區別,并說明為何缺少mybatis.mapper-locations配置會導致...
站長的頭像-小浪學習網月度會員站長3個月前
3410
在IDEA中連接Oracle數據庫時如何解決數字溢出錯誤?-小浪學習網

在IDEA中連接Oracle數據庫時如何解決數字溢出錯誤?

IntelliJ IDEA連接Oracle數據庫:數字溢出錯誤排查指南 在使用IntelliJ IDEA連接Oracle數據庫時,您可能會遇到惱人的“數字溢出”錯誤。此錯誤通常發生在連接數據庫或執行查詢操作期間,導致操...
站長的頭像-小浪學習網月度會員站長2個月前
229
Navicat執行SQL語句后查看執行時間和性能分析-小浪學習網

Navicat執行SQL語句后查看執行時間和性能分析

在navicat中查看sql語句的執行時間和進行性能分析的方法如下:1.執行sql查詢后,查看查詢結果窗口底部的“query took”部分以獲取執行時間。2.使用“explain”功能查看查詢計劃,分析索引使用和...
站長的頭像-小浪學習網月度會員站長1個月前
3810
使用游標遍歷Oracle表數據的詳細示例-小浪學習網

使用游標遍歷Oracle表數據的詳細示例

使用游標可以高效地從oracle數據庫中讀取大數據量。1) 聲明游標并指定sql查詢。2) 打開游標執行查詢。3) 逐行提取數據。4) 關閉游標釋放資源,這樣可以節省內存并提高性能。 引言 在處理大數據...
站長的頭像-小浪學習網月度會員站長1個月前
2311
mysql中as有除以的意思嗎 as關鍵字和除法運算符的區別-小浪學習網

mysql中as有除以的意思嗎 as關鍵字和除法運算符的區別

在mysql中,as關鍵字用于為列或表指定別名,而/是用于執行除法運算的數學運算符。1. as關鍵字的使用可以提高查詢的可讀性和管理性,例如在復雜的join查詢中為表指定別名。2. /運算符常用于計算...
站長的頭像-小浪學習網月度會員站長43天前
397